Don't Do What Dimon Does

Seems Dimon may be in trouble for "market abuse" in Sweden now because of his "remarks" being perfectly timed with a fall in bitcoin price and his company JP Morgan buying Bitcoin during that dip. You can read more on this story at Bitcoin.com here.

I think I have made my thoughts about such declarations pretty clear in the past what surprises me is that some people still seem to panic sell based on these kind of bullshit "opinions".

Suffice it to say you should not trust people who stand to benefit from these kind of announcements. They are likely profiting off your fear.
